Change Fan State and Displays
You can change the fan state of wire stubs and cable wire stubs using Fan In
and Fan Out on the Nailboard tab, Edit panel, or right-click to use the context
menu.
Fanned out wire stubs are always displayed using the current wire display
setting. Once the nailboard is created, you can change the sorting direction
and angle using Fan Out on the Nailboard tab, or right-click and use the
context menu.
There are two options for displaying wire and cable wire stubs that are fanned
in:
■ Display as segment - use the diameter and color of the associated segment
and the length of the longest wire.
■ Display as longest wire - use the diameter, color, and length of the longest
wire.
